Terry started his illustrious career at the age of
four as a child actor. In 1954 he performed in twp movies,
the first “Dance with me Henry” starring
Abbot and Lou Costello; the second “Trooper Hook”
starring Barbara Stanwyc and Joel McRae. “Trooper
Hook” still plays occasionally on late night television.
Terry also acted in a string of TV shows and commercials
from The Lone Ranger, The Millionaire, The Tennessee
Ernie Ford Show and The Art Linkletter Show. His commercial
credits include Pillsbury, Franco American, the first
Jiff Peanut Butter commercials in 1960, a Cracker Jack
commercial with Johnny Crawford from the Rifleman and
Jay North from Dennis the Menace.
Retiring from show business, by honorary withdrawal
from AFTRA and Actors Screen Guild at the ripe age of
eleven, Terry pursued another passion of his, music.
He studied music from age 6 to 14 on Piano, Organ and
guitar and has played professionally from 1964 to present
in a group managed by Bill Medley of the righteous Bros.
Terry toured with legends such as Ike & Tina Turner,
Little Richard, Louis Prima, Sam Buttera, James Brown,
Jose Feliciano, The Fearson Foursome, Freddy Fender,
War, Tower of Power, Manhattan Transfer, Trini Lopez,
Tom Rotella and many others.
Terry’s has album credits with recording artist
such as Clayton Rose, Leff Rodgers, Apple Jacl, good
News, Froce, heathens, Scandal, Churchill Downs all
on keyboards and vocals. He also has lead vocal album
credits with Mick Terry.
Today Terry brings talents and experience with him
to accompany local Los Angeles and Orange county bands.
